I can't overstate how much I dislike thumb trackball mice for games. The thumb didn't evolve to be dexterous for minute movements like the middle fingers. Trying to aim with the thumb in a game that requires speed and precision is just a recipe for strain.

The Steam Controller is also centered on thumb trackball -like touchpads, but it gets a pass for not having a huge physical ball to manipulate and strain against, and having a gyro for those minute aim adjustments.

Wrist pain? Just get a cheap as fuck vertical mouse model.

Spreadsheet work and browsing? Get what you want. I actually have an M570 (fell for the thumb trackball meme), now relegated to remote control from my bed, works fine for that.

>>62297747
Fair bit of warning. I've used the heck out of this trackball and I really find comfy, but the switches for the clicks will likely wear out after about 2 years. Eventually, it'll start to unintentionally double click or fail to hold a click at all.

I'm making a jump to the new Elecom thumb trackball mouse and will see how that fairs.
